2013-08-28hw: Clean up bogus default boot orderMarkus Armbruster1-1/+0
We set default boot order "cad" in every single machine definition except "pseries" and "moxiesim", even though very few boards actually care for boot order, and "cad" makes sense for even fewer. Machines that care: * pc and its variants Accept up to three letters 'a', 'b' (undocumented alias for 'a'), 'c', 'd' and 'n'. Reject all others (fatal with -boot). * nseries (n800, n810) Check whether order starts with 'n'. Silently ignored otherwise. * prep, g3beige, mac99 Extract the first character the machine understands (subset of 'a'..'f'). Silently ignored otherwise. * spapr Accept an arbitrary string (vl.c restricts it to contain only 'a'..'p', no duplicates). * sun4[mdc] Use the first character. Silently ignored otherwise. Strip characters these machines ignore from their default boot order. For all other machines, remove the unused default boot order alltogether. Note that my rename of QEMUMachine member boot_order to default_boot_order and QEMUMachineInitArgs member boot_device to boot_order has a welcome side effect: it makes every use of boot orders visible in this patch, for easy review. 2013-08-08mips: revert commit b332d24a8e1290954029814d09156b06ede358e2Aurelien Jarno1-3/+4
Now that this code path is not triggered anymore during the tests, revert commit b332d24a8e1290954029814d09156b06ede358e2. Booting a MIPS target without kernel nor bios doesn't really make sense. 2013-07-29hw/mips: align initrd to 64KB to avoid kernel errorJames Hogan1-1/+1
The Linux kernel can be configured to use 64KB pages, but it also requires initrd to be page aligned. Therefore, to be safe, align the initrd to 64KB using a new INITRD_PAGE_MASK rather than TARGET_PAGE_MASK.
